About Swan
Swan is Europe’s embedded banking specialist. We empower software companies to embed banking features like accounts, cards, and payments directly into their products, under their own brand. Swan processes over €1.5 billion in monthly transactions for more than 150 companies—like Pennylane, Indy, Agicap, Libeo, and Lucca. Founded in 2019, the company has received growth capital from leading investors such as Lakestar, Accel, Creandum, Bpifrance and Eight Roads. Swan is a principal member of Mastercard and a licensed financial institution, regulated by the French banking authority (ACPR).

Swan primarily onboards small and medium-sized companies and self-employed freelancers opening business accounts. While we use the term "KYC," it also refers to Know-Your-Business (KYB) processes.
